“…It can be observed that the conductance spectra for present alginate-LiBr BBPEs comprise three regions. The lowfrequency dispersion region (where an increase in conductivity is observed with increase in frequency) is attributed to space charge polarization at the electrodeelectrolyte interface [9]. The intermediate frequency independent plateau region corresponds to the bulk conductivity or dc conductivity σ dc of the complex BBPEs system [10].…”
